刚接触.NET编程的朋友,是不是经常卡在“网站代码写好了,但不知道怎么把它放到网上让大家访问”这一步?🤔 别担心,今天我们就来聊聊这个让很多新手头疼的问题——怎么搭建和部署.NET网站,顺带聊聊大家关心的价格和空间问题!
我见过不少新手,代码写得不错,但一说到“虚拟主机”、“部署”就有点发懵。其实这事儿就像租房子,找到合适的“家”,你的网站才能安稳住下来。
🛠️ 手把手带你搭建.NET网站搭建一个.NET网站,其实没有想象中那么复杂。我把它梳理成了几个清晰的步骤,咱们一步步来看:
选个靠谱的虚拟主机服务商
这是最基础也是最重要的一步!你得找一个明确支持.NET框架的主机商。购买时,留意它支持的ASP.NET版本和SQL Server数据库版本,确保和你的程序匹配。有些便宜的主机可能只支持老版本,这点要特别注意!
获取主机信息并连接
购买成功后,你会收到主机商发来的FTP账号密码和控制面板登录信息。FTP就像一把钥匙,能让你把本地文件上传到服务器。我常用的FileZilla,免费又稳定,把网站文件拖拽到远程站点的 wwwroot或 public_html目录就行了。
配置数据库
如果你的网站用了数据库,需要在主机控制面板里(比如Plesk或cPanel)创建一个数据库,并记下数据库名、用户名、密码和服务器地址。然后,记得去更新你网站配置文件(比如Web.config)里的数据库连接字符串。
最后的测试与优化
在浏览器输入你的域名,看看网站是否正常显示。多点几个功能试试,特别是涉及数据库读写的部分,比如用户注册、登录。没问题的话,可以考虑进一步做SEO优化或者加强安全设置。
💰 关于租用价格,你得知道这些很多人最关心的就是价格了。.NET虚拟主机的租用价格差异很大,这主要取决于你需要的功能和服务水平 。
基础型:通常适合个人博客或展示类小网站,可能几十到百来块一年,但资源(如CPU、内存、流量)会有限制。
企业型:如果需要运行更复杂的应用程序或期望更高的性能,价格自然会更高,可能从几百到上千元每年不等。
我的看法是,别一味图便宜。价格过低可能意味着技术支持响应慢、服务器不稳定或者隐藏收费项目。多看看用户评价,特别是关于技术支持的反馈,这能在你遇到问题时帮上大忙!
🗑️ 网站空间告急?试试这几招运行一段时间后,你可能会收到“磁盘空间不足”的警告。别慌,可以试试下面几个方法:
清理“垃圾”:检查并删除不必要的备份文件、临时日志文件和无用的测试数据。我个人建议,定期清理日志是释放空间最直接有效的方法之一。
压缩与归档:将一些早期的大文件(比如用户上传的图片、文档)压缩,或者转移到专门的云存储(比如阿里云OSS、腾讯云COS),这样可以极大减轻主机的空间压力。
终极方案:升级配置:如果网站发展很快,内容持续增加,最根本的办法还是升级你的主机套餐,获得更大的存储空间。
🚀 我的个人心得与建议从我自己的经验来看,对于.NET新手,稳定性、技术支持和服务商的口碑,应该放在比价格更优先的位置。一个随时能联系上、能快速解决问题的技术支持,比你省下那几十块钱重要得多。
另外,在正式部署前,务必在本地进行彻底的测试,这能避免很多上线后才发现的问题,节省大量折腾的时间。
希望这篇啰啰嗦嗦的分享,能帮你理清思路,更顺利地让你的.NET网站在互联网上安家!🚀 你在搭建网站的过程中,还遇到过哪些奇葩问题?或者对选择主机有什么独家心得?欢迎在评论区一起交流呀!👇
免责声明:网所有文字、图片、视频、音频等资料均来自互联网,不代表本站赞同其观点,内容仅提供用户参考,若因此产生任何纠纷,本站概不负责,如有侵权联系本站删除!邮箱:207985384@qq.com https://www.ainiseo.com/hosting/51718.html